Using an ipad in Light Painting


because the ipad is almost entirely made up a hi-res screen it is very useful in lighting painting. because it allows for the creation of an almost infinite number of combinations of lights and shape to create very impressive light painting on the final frame.


This is one of the most successful images from my first session using an ipad for light drawing. the image displaying on the ipad was a static white circle on a black background. moving the ipad through the fame produced the cylinder effect.

These are some of the best images from my weekend photoshoot in derby:

For this photo I used a Speedlight mounted on my camera and a secondary Speedlight at camara left to give a contrasting light to the side of the models face. The red highlights on the righthand side are from a old side street light giving out a very warm glow, to take advantage of that I used a fairly long exposure to give time for the ambient light to fill the photo.
